In utility-scale and commercial applications where cycle count and duration fall within 2-4 hour ranges, LFP consistently delivers the lowest total cost of ownership. Typical containerized systems deliver 4.0-5.0 MWh per container at approximately 2.5 MW power capacity, optimizing the balance between energy capacity and power delivery that most grid applications require.


When your business model depends on arbitrage—buying power at off-peak rates and selling during peak demand—every dollar per kWh matters, and LFP’s cost structure sets the industry standard.

Graphene Vs. Lithium Ion

Lithium-ion batteries have dominated the energy storage market for decades, powering everything from smartphones to electric vehicles. However, they suffer from limitations such as thermal runaway risks, limited lifespan, and environmental concerns related to the mining and disposal of rare earth minerals. Graphene addresses these challenges, offering a safer, more sustainable, and longer-lasting alternative.
